Balagram, Idukki, Kerala, India, 685552
Thankamany, Idukki, Kerala, India, 685609
Thopramkudy, Idukki, Kerala, India, 685609
Panickankudy, Idukki, Kerala, India, 685571
Rajamudi, Idukki, Kerala, India, 685604
Hotels - ,Restaurant -
Restaurant - ,Village Foods -
Best Hotels in Idukki - ,Best Restaurent in Adimali - ,Hotels - ,Restaurant -